Well directed and intriguing psychological story of the aftermath of the Second World War. A nazi and his son hide in an old farm in the Black Forest, terrorizing the resident family. They would like to escape to Switzerland, yet the dramatic dynamics among the five characters get in the way.

As with many German movies, the sound is terrible. On the one the hand, the movement of shoes on the wooden floors is loud and omnipresent, yet the voices are subdued and the conversations impossible to discern. This makes understanding the plot hard. Even the French soldiers are easier to understand.

The movie way shot in the buildings of the open-air museum in Gutach.
